Citrulline is an amino acid that plays a crucial role in improving blood flow and increasing nitric oxide levels, which can lead to enhanced exercise performance. Many athletes and fitness enthusiasts have turned to citrulline supplements to help reduce muscle soreness and fatigue during intense training sessions.
One of the key benefits of citrulline is its ability to enhance endurance. By improving blood circulation, it allows for better delivery of oxygen and nutrients to your muscles, which can help you push through those last few reps. Additionally, citrulline has been shown to aid in recovery post-workout, helping to alleviate muscle soreness and stiffness.
When choosing a citrulline supplement, look for products that contain pure L-citrulline or citrulline malate for optimal results. It's also important to consider the dosage; most studies suggest a daily intake of 6-8 grams for effective benefits.

FAQs
What is citrulline supplement used for?
Citrulline supplement is primarily used to enhance athletic performance, improve blood flow, and reduce muscle soreness.
How does citrulline work?
Citrulline works by increasing nitric oxide levels in the body, which improves blood circulation and nutrient delivery to muscles.
When should I take citrulline supplements?
It's best to take citrulline supplements about 30-60 minutes before your workout for optimal results.
Are there any side effects of citrulline?
Citrulline is generally considered safe, but some individuals may experience mild digestive discomfort.
Can citrulline help with recovery?
Yes, citrulline can aid in recovery by reducing muscle soreness and improving overall recovery time after workouts.
